Develop Your Own Recipes And Impress Your Family And Friends
by Cynthia MacGregor
Where do all those yummy recipes come from that we all enjoy digging into? SOMEBODY created ("developed," in proper cooking parlance) every one of them. Have YOU ever wanted to develop your own recipes? Imagine your sense of pride when a guest (or family member) tastes one of your creations, says, "This is great! Where'd you get the recipe?" and you can answer, "It's my own recipe! I came up with it myself!" Ever wonder how? This book will show you! You'll soon be proudly serving your own creations in the kitchen.
About The Author:
Author of over 50 published books, South Florida resident Cynthia MacGregor is a freelance writer/editor whose varied career has included writing, editing, theatre-reviewing, and teaching adult classes in writing, public speaking, and cooking.
